The company was established in 1924 in Milwaukee, Wisconsin, by A. F. Siebert, and was named the Milwaukee Electric Tool Corporation. It was mainly engaged in making top quality electric tool repairs, and then expanded its operations by including the refurbishing of other tools as well. Milwaukee Electric Tool Corporation's current products numbering to almost 500 power tool models, its accessories and parts include the following: generators, band saws, drain cleaners, drill presses, electric drills, grinders, hammer drills, heat guns, hoists, impact drivers, impact wrenches, jig saws, job site radios, lighting, miter saws, nailers, nibblers/shearers, polishers, rotary hammers, routers, sanders, Sawzalls, screwdrivers and vacuums. It comes in the voltage configurations in the 12v, 18v, 28v, 120v, and 230v. Presently based in Brookfield, Wisconsin, Milwaukee Tools is owned and operated by Techtronic Industries Co., Ltd., of Hong Kong.
